A six-week course for ages 10 to 14 designed to spark interest in programming and robotics through guided instruction by experienced high school mentors

The Richard Montgomery High School robotics team, Rocket Robotics, is excited to offer a free, 6-week coding course for middle school students, designed to introduce beginners to the fundamentals of programming and spark interest in programming and robotics. This hands-on course will cover the fundamentals of coding using one of the most popular programming languages, Java. Students will receive guided instruction over the 6 session course which will help them understand key concepts (such as basic Java syntax, control structures like loops and if statements, working with arrays, creating reusable methods) and get set up to further advance their coding skills.

Experienced high school mentors will guide the participants, providing personalized support and encouragement. With each session building on the last, students will not only gain a solid foundation in Java programming that they can apply in robotics and other coding projects, but also the confidence to explore further in the world of technology and robotics. Whether you're new to coding or looking to strengthen your skills, this course will provide a supportive and engaging environment to get started with Java.

Students are encouraged to come to all 6 sessions but are also welcome to sign up for as many or as few as possible. 

Students may bring their own laptop computers, if possible, but laptops will be available for student use during the course if not!

Course runs February 3 - March 17. Registration required -- limited to 15 students.

For ages 10 to 14.
